Cecal web is a rare entity. We find few cases of cecal web presenting in adult patient as a mass lesion (Gayner et al., 1977) or radiologically space occupying lesion (Raymond et al., 1983; Guttman et al., 1975) but an extensive search of published reports failed to find a case of the cecal web or similar abnormality in neonatal group presenting as an acute intestinal obstruction. Microcolon (unused colon) is not a common problem in neonates. Radiographic contrast medium enema shows a small caliber colon. This report concerns 12 neonates with microcolon, all identified between January 1995 and June 1997 by contrast medium colon study. BACKGROUND Hirschsprung's disease (HD) is characterized by a lack of ganglion cells in the myenteric and submucosal plexus, associated with increased numbers of acetyl cholinesterase (AChE) positive nerve fibres.
